Avocado and Joya Appetizer – A Modern and Delicious Garlic Dip
Total Time: 15 minutes
Servings: 4

Necessary Ingredients
- 1 ripe avocado (choose an avocado with green skin that feels slightly soft to the touch)
- 4-5 cloves of garlic (for an intense flavor, use fresh garlic)
- Iodized salt (to taste)
- 1 cup of Joya natural yogurt (ideal for adding a creamy touch)
- Walnut oil (or another quality oil, to bring a distinct flavor)
- Freshly ground pepper (to taste)
Step by Step for a Perfect Result
1. Preparing the Ingredients
Start by selecting a ripe avocado. Choose one that feels slightly soft to the touch but not overly ripe. Cut it in half, remove the pit, and scoop the flesh into a bowl with a spoon. This is the perfect time to wear gloves, as avocado can leave stains on your skin.
2. Cleaning the Garlic
Meanwhile, peel the garlic cloves. If you want to reduce the intensity of the garlic flavor, you can let them soak in a bowl of cold water for 10-15 minutes before adding them to the chopper.
3. Mixing
Put the avocado flesh, peeled garlic cloves, salt, pepper, and Joya yogurt in the food processor. Add the walnut oil, but don't overdo it – add the oil gradually to control the consistency. Blend everything for about 3 minutes until you achieve a smooth and creamy paste. You can adjust the consistency with a little oil or water if necessary.
4. Final Tasting
Once you have a fine paste, taste the mixture and adjust the salt and pepper to your preference. If you like a stronger garlic flavor, you can add another clove or two.
5. Serving
Transfer the avocado paste to a serving bowl. You can garnish with a little walnut oil on top or with a few slices of avocado for an appealing look. Serve this appetizer with fries for a vegan option or alongside grilled meat for a delicious contrast.
Useful Tips
- Choosing the Avocado: Make sure the avocado is ripe. If you're unsure, you can let the avocado ripen at room temperature for a few days.
- Garlic-Free Version: For a milder version, you can omit the garlic or replace it with a few fresh basil leaves. This will provide a fresh and subtle flavor.
- Enhancing Flavor: If you're looking for a more sophisticated flavor, you can add a few drops of lemon juice for a pleasant contrast or even some spices like smoked paprika.
Nutritional Benefits
This avocado and Joya yogurt appetizer is not only delicious but also extremely nutritious. Avocado is rich in essential fatty acids, vitamins E, C, B6, and K, while Joya natural yogurt adds a boost of protein and probiotics. It is an ideal appetizer for those who want to maintain a healthy lifestyle.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Can I use frozen avocado? While it's better to use fresh avocado, you can use frozen avocado. Just make sure it is well thawed before use.
- How do I store avocado? If you have leftover avocado, store it in an airtight container with a little lemon juice to prevent oxidation.
- Is it vegan? Yes, this recipe is completely vegan, considering you use Joya yogurt, which is plant-based.
